Missouri City Fire Department Seeking Potential Witness
The Missouri City Fire & Rescue Service is seeking a potential eyewitness to a commercial structure fire that occurred on Aug. 15, 2011 at about 12:45 a.m.
The incident happened inside the Walgreens store located at 6120 Hwy. 6 in Missouri City, Texas. When the City Fire Department responded, firefighters observed heavy smoke coming from the building. The incident commander secured the area and Investigator Rios went inside to inspect the fire scene. He concluded that fire damage was isolated to a “relatively small area” but the entire structure had extensive water and smoke damage. Rios also reviewed store surveillance footage that was recorded prior to the fire and it showed an unidentified man entering the store. Officials believe the man could have witnessed the incident and would like to identify and contact him.
The potential witness is Hispanic Male, late 20’s-mid 30’s, 240-250 Lbs., Black short hair and goatee, Black “Under Armor” baseball cap, Black T-shirt, Blue jeans, White basketball shoes. (Please see attached images for reference.)
